Best Shelby County Public Middle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 6 public middle schools serving 1,159 students in Shelby County, IL.
The top-ranked public middle schools in Shelby County, IL are Moulton Elementary School, Cowden-herrick Jr/sr High School and Stewardson-strasburg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Shelby County, IL public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the Illinois public middle school average of 24%), and reading proficiency score of 41% (versus the 29% statewide average). Middle schools in Shelby County have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Illinois public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public middle school average of 61% (majority Hispanic).
